在现代网络生活中,网页内容的版权保护变得尤为重要。许多网站和内容创作者都希望通过禁用右键功能来防止内容的非法复制和传播。网页如何禁用右键呢?以下是一些实用的方法。
 
一、使用JavaScript代码禁用右键
 
1.在网页的标签中添加以下JavaScript代码:
 
document.oncontextmenu=function(){returnfalse
 
这段代码会在用户尝试右键点击时,阻止默认的右键菜单弹出。
 
二、使用CSS样式禁用右键
 
1.在网页的标签中添加以下CSS样式:
 
body{webkit-user-select:none
moz-user-select:none
ms-user-select:none
user-select:none
 
通过禁用用户的选取功能,可以间接阻止右键菜单的弹出。
 
三、利用HTML5的右键禁用属性
 
1.在需要禁用右键的元素上添加属性:
 
 
这样,当用户尝试右键点击图片时,会阻止默认的右键菜单弹出。
 
四、使用JavaScript库禁用右键
 
1.引入一个JavaScript库,如jQuery:
 
 
2.在页面加载完成后,使用jQuery禁用右键:
 
$(document).ready(function(){$(document).on('contextmenu',function(e){
returnfalse
 
五、在服务器端禁用右键
 
1.修改服务器端的配置文件,如Apache的httpd.conf文件。
 
2.添加以下配置:
 
OrderAllow,Deny Denyfromall 
这样,服务器会阻止访问图片等文件时弹出右键菜单。
 
以上方法都可以在一定程度上禁用网页的右键功能,但需要注意的是,这些方法可能并不能完全阻止有经验的用户通过某些技术手段绕过限制。在实际应用中,还需要结合其他版权保护措施,共同维护网站内容的版权。